外周损伤对脊髓P物质免疫反应的影响及Mel1a受体在脊髓中的定位

Effect of Peripheral Injury on Substance P Immunoreactivity in Spinal Cord and Localization of Mel1a Receptor in Spinal Cord

【作者】 韩莹

【导师】 鲁亚平;

【作者基本信息】 安徽师范大学 , 动物学, 2007, 硕士

【摘要】 1. P物质是一种神经肽,脊髓P物质主要在背根中与疼痛调节相关的小型初级感觉传入神经中表达,在中枢和周围神经系统起着重要作用。运用免疫组织化学和光密度测定法,观察中华大蟾蜍坐骨神经横断后脊髓中P物质的变化。在对照动物中,背外侧束中P物质免疫反应纤维密度最高,胞体内没有发现任何P物质免疫阳性标记。手术后,损伤侧背外侧束中的P物质免疫反应纤维减少。这种变化是在轴突损伤3天(0.84±0.02)后观察到的,并且在第8天(0.50±0.03)和第15天(0.45±0.04)持续出现,在第20天(0.60±0.04)、30天(0.69±0.03),手术侧和对照侧之间已经没有明显的区别,表明P物质表达的恢复。这些结果说明中华大蟾蜍可以用作研究周围损伤影响的模型,对阐明P物质在疼痛神经病患者中的作用会有所帮助。2.褪黑素是一种具有广泛生理功能的神经内分泌激素,通过与其受体的结合来实现对中枢神经系统的调节作用。为了进一步了解褪黑素对脊髓不同板层的调节差异,我们运用免疫荧光化学方法,观察了Mel1a受体在无蹼壁虎脊髓中的分布,并对阳性结果进行统计分析。结果显示I-V和X板层的Mel1a受体免疫阳性细胞胞体形体较小,形态多为圆形;VII层的阳性细胞形体较大,形态不规则,呈圆形、三角形或椭圆形三种。统计结果表明,VI层(22.36±2.36个/mm2)、VIII层(24.07±2.05个/mm2)和IX层(30.56±2.87个/mm2)较I-V层(450.25±9.65个/mm2)阳性细胞明显偏少(P<0.05);VII层(476.90±11.26个/mm2)和X(480.64±12.98个/mm2)板层阳性反应细胞密度同I-V板层(450.25±9.65个/mm2)相比没有显著性差异(P>0.05)。提示褪黑素通过其受体介导除了对脊髓的感觉传输具有调节作用以外,还可能参与调节爬行动物的运动功能。

【Abstract】 1. Substance P is a neuropeptide prominently expressed in small primary sensory afferents that is involved in the modulation of pain-related information in the spinal dorsal horn.Using immunohistochemistry and optical densitometry, substance P was investigated in Bufo bufo gargarizans spinal cord after sciatic nerve transection. In control animals, there was a high density of substance P fibers in the Lissauer’s tract. No substance P label was found in any cell bodies. After axotomy, substance P immunoreactive fibers decreased in the Lissauer’s tract on the same side of the lesion. The changes were observed at 3 days(0.84±0.02) following axonal injury and persisted at 8(0.50±0.03) and 15 days(0.45±0.04). At 20 days(0.60±0.04) and 30 days(0.69±0.03), there was no significant difference between the axotomized side and the control one, thus indicating a recovery of the substance P expression. These results indicate that Bufo bufo gargarizans may be used as a model to study the effects of peripheral axotomy, contributing to elucidate the Substance P actions in the pain neuropath.2. Melatonin is a kind of neuroendocrine hormone, which regulates the functions of Central Nervous System(CNS) by its receptors.In order to learn more about the regulatory function of melatonin to different lamina of spinal cord, we localized and characterized Mel1a receptor in the spinal cord of Gecko swinhoniss by immunofluorescence. Studies demonstrated the presence of Mel1a receptor located mainly in laminae I-V, lamina VII and lamina X of the spinal cord. The positive cells were small and mostly round in laminae I-V and X, while in lamina VII the positive cells were large and the shapes in them were cycloidal, triangle and elliptical. The statistical results showed that the positive cells in lamina VI(22.36±2.36/mm2), lamina VIII(24.07±2.05 /mm2) and lamina IX(30.56±2.87/mm2) were evidently lesser than those in laminae I-V(450.25±9.65/mm2)(P<0.05); The positive cells in lamina VII(476.90±11.26/mm2) and lamina X(480.64±12.98/mm2) did not have significant difference with those in laminae I-V(P>0.05). These results indicate that melatonin in spinal cord may play a role in the movement of reptile by its receptors besides the modulatory effect of melatonin on the mechanisms of sensory transmission of the spinal cord.
